Multi-Layered Encryption and Key Fragmentation
Data is protected using AES-256 encryption combined with Shamir’s Secret Sharing scheme. Private keys are split into fragments stored across geographically dispersed servers, so a breach at any single point yields nothing useful. The team regularly rotates encryption algorithms based on quantum computing advancements, ensuring resistance against future decryption capabilities. Each asset transfer requires multi-signature approval from independent nodes, adding a human verification layer to automated checks.

Zero-Trust Access Controls
Every access request undergoes continuous verification using device fingerprinting, geolocation anomalies, and biometric authentication. Users cannot bypass these checks even with valid credentials if the context seems risky. For example, a login attempt from an unrecognized IP address triggers a secondary verification via hardware token. This model eliminates reliance on perimeter security, treating every interaction as potentially hostile.
